Contingency theory is a leadership framework that posits that the effectiveness of a leader's style is contingent upon the context in which they operate, including factors like the environment, organizational structure, and the characteristics of followers. This theory emphasizes that there is no single best way to lead; instead, the optimal leadership approach varies depending on situational variables. It challenges traditional leadership theories by acknowledging the complexity of human behavior and organizational dynamics.
